Getting from Bristol airport to the city center

Bristol is served by Bristol Airport (BRS), located 13 km southwest of the city center. The airport offers several airport transfers to city center destinations, including express bus services, taxis, ride-hailing, and private transfers. The Bristol Airport Flyer is the most popular public transport option, providing frequent connections to Bristol Temple Meads station and the city center. Journey times and costs vary depending on traffic conditions and time of day.

Notes:

  • Prices in GBP; table created in 2025 and subject to change.
  • The Bristol Airport Flyer (A1) runs between the airport and Bristol Temple Meads station via the city center.
  • There is no direct rail link to Bristol Airport; the bus is the main public transport option.
  • Taxi and ride-hailing journey times vary significantly depending on traffic conditions.
